Excel按部门批量生成文件夹

在现代企业中,文档管理是一个必不可少的环节,而文件夹的分类和管理更是保证工作效率的重要手段。如果你的团队按部门进行工作,如何迅速地为每个部门生成专属的文件夹呢?本文将详细介绍如何利用Excel来批量生成文件夹,以实现高效的文档管理。

1. 准备Excel文件

首先,我们需要准备一个Excel文件,其中包含你希望为每个部门生成文件夹的名称。这一步非常重要,因为文件夹名称的准确性将直接影响到后续的操作效率。

在Excel中,你可以创建一个名为“部门名称”的列,逐行填写各个部门的名称,如“人事部”、“财务部”、“市场部”等。如果部门很多,你还可以考虑使用数据验证功能,从而保证输入的名称规范且统一。

Excel按部门批量生成文件夹

1.1 创建基础数据

使用Excel创建文件夹名称时,可以按照以下步骤进行操作:选择一个空白工作表,命名列头为“部门名称”,然后在下面的单元格中输入各个部门的名称。

为了提高工作效率,建议你将各个部门的名称列表整理好并复制到Excel中,确保每个名称占据一个独立的单元格。这样,可以避免重复输入和错误输入的发生。

1.2 检查数据完整性

在输入数据后,别忘了检查一遍。可以使用Excel的排序和筛选功能,确保每个部门名称都没有拼写错误或重复的情况。通过这种方式,你可以最大程度地减少后续操作中的错误。

2. 使用VBA批量生成文件夹

接下来,我们将使用Excel的VBA功能来批量生成文件夹。VBA(Visual Basic for Applications)是一种强大的编程语言,可以帮助你自动化许多重复的任务,在这里,我们将用它来创建文件夹。

在Excel中,按下 Alt + F11 键,进入VBA界面。在菜单中选择“插入” -> “模块”,然后粘贴以下代码:

Sub CreateFolders()

Dim folderName As String

Dim cell As Range

' 设置文件夹路径(这里可以修改为你希望存放文件夹的路径)

Dim baseFolder As String

baseFolder = "C:\你的文件夹路径\"

' 遍历每个部门名称

For Each cell In ThisWorkbook.Sheets(1].Range("A1:A" & Cells(Rows.Count, 1).End(xlUp).Row)

folderName = cell.Value

If folderName <> "" Then

' 创建文件夹

MkDir baseFolder & folderName

End If

Next cell

End Sub

在代码中,baseFolder 变量需要根据你的需求修改为实际的文件夹路径。在对应的路径下,代码会根据Excel里的部门名称生成相应的文件夹。

2.1 运行VBA代码

完成代码输入后,关闭VBA窗口,返回Excel。在Excel中,你可以按 Alt + F8,选择刚才创建的“CreateFolders”宏,然后点击“运行”,就可以自动生成文件夹了。

当程序运行完成后,检查相应的文件路径,你将发现每个部门对应的文件夹均已成功创建。这一过程不仅节约了大量时间,也大大降低了手动操作所可能带来的错误。

3. 后续管理与维护

文件夹生成后,管理与维护同样重要。为不同部门创建了文件夹后,建议定期检查这些文件夹的使用情况,确保文件得到了合理的存储与归类。

可以考虑为每个部门指定负责人员,定期更新文件夹内的文件内容,并对不再使用的文件进行清理。此外,也可以利用Excel记录每个文件夹的使用情况,以便于进行后续的管理与调整。

3.1 建立文件夹使用规范

为了进一步提升文件夹的管理效率,可以考虑为每个部门建立文件夹使用规范,例如规定文件命名规则、存储流程等。这些规范有助于保证文件内容的整洁与有序,使得以后查找与使用时更加方便。

通过这些措施,可以确保部门文件夹的管理更加高效,也让团队成员能在一个干净整齐的环境中工作,提升整体的工作效率。

总结

通过使用Excel批量生成文件夹,可以大大减少手动创建文件夹的时间,提升工作效率。本文详细介绍了从准备数据到使用VBA生成文件夹的全过程,希望这对您管理部门文件夹有所帮助。

在实施过程中,可以根据企业的实际需求对流程进行灵活调整,确保每个部门能拥有一个清晰且易于管理的文件存放空间。将这样的系统化流程融入企业日常管理中,无疑将促进企业的整体发展与效率提升。

相关内容

  • excel文档如何按首字的笔画排序
  • 在日常工作中,我们常常需要对数据进行排序,以便更好地进行分析和使用。特别是对于中文数据的排序,不同于字母的自然顺序,中文的排序通常需要按照字的笔画或拼音进行排序...
  • 2025-01-15 16:09:57

    1

  • Excel正则表达式提取有两位小数的正实数的操作
  • 在日常的数据处理和分析中,Excel是一款非常强大的工具。然而,当我们需要从大量的数据中提取特定格式的数值时,简单的公式往往无法满足需求。这时,使用正则表达式提...
  • 2025-01-15 16:09:32

    1

  • Excel根据单元格数值生成一个算术表达式
  • 在现代办公中,Excel已成为一种不可或缺的工具,尤其是在数据处理与分析方面。通过使用Excel,我们不仅可以轻松进行数据计算,还能根据单元格中的数值生成复杂的...
  • 2025-01-15 16:09:10

    1

  • EXCEL查询指定区域最大值的地址
  • 在日常工作中,Excel是一个不可或缺的数据处理工具。而在处理大量数据时,我们常常需要找到某个区域的最大值,以及这个最大值所在的具体地址。本文将详细介绍如何使用...
  • 2025-01-15 16:08:52

    1

  • excel求和怎么做
  • 在现代办公中,Excel作为一种强大的电子表格工具,被广泛应用于数据处理和分析。其中,求和功能是Excel中最基本、最常用的功能之一。本文将详细介绍Excel求...
  • 2025-01-15 16:08:35

    1

  • Excel文档怎么合并单元格
  • Excel是一款功能强大的电子表格软件,广泛应用于数据分析、财务管理等多个领域。在日常使用中,很多用户会需要合并单元格,以便更好地呈现数据或提高表格的可读性。本...
  • 2025-01-15 16:08:14

    1